> You are correct - there is a bug in the function when used in a VM since all 
> devices appear as part of the same bus, which leads to the driver counting 
> all devices.
> 
> I'm not sure if there is a good way around this. When the device is direct 
> attached in a VM we may not be able to tell if it's part of a multiport NIC.
> 
> Thanks,
> Emil

This is not the only problem in this area. In my experience, all functions of a 
NIC that are direct attached will have a subfunction number of 0 in a VM. This 
means that there is no way to make the NIC look like it should in the VM.

I take the issues in this area to largely be the result of deficiencies in the 
hypervisor and that they really should be addressed there. Principally, there 
needs to be a hypervisor supporting a PCIe guest architecture.

>>>> I am testing ixgbe-3.19.1 with my dual port x540 10G Base-
>> T
>>>> card (PCIe
>>>> passthrough into a Ubuntu 12.10 VM).
>>>> I am seeing a warning like this -
>>>> 
>>>> "This is not sufficient for optimal performance of this
>>>> card. For optimal
>>>> performance , at least 80 GT/s of bandwidth is required."
>>>> 
>>>> This is not correct because I have a dual 10G port card
>> and
>>>> have a PCIe
>>>> Gen2 based system and the card is in a x8 slot. So B/W
>>>> should not be an
>>>> issue
>>>> On tracing the code it seems like a bug in ->
>>>> 
>>>> static inline int ixgbe_enumerate_functions(struct
>>>> ixgbe_adapter *adapter)
>>>> {
>>>>       struct list_head *entry;
>>>>       int physfns = 0;
>>>> 
>>>>       /* Some cards can not use the generic count PCIe
>>>> functions method,
>>>>        * because they are behind a parent switch, so we
>>>> hardcode these to
>>>>        * correct number of ports.
>>>>        */
>>>>       if (ixgbe_pcie_from_parent(&adapter->hw)) {
>>>>               physfns = 4;
>>>>       } else {
>>>>               list_for_each(entry, &adapter->pdev-
>>>>> bus_list) {
>>>> <-------------- This counts all pcie devices in the system
>>>> not just the
>>>> ones matching this card/intel NIC
>>>> #ifdef CONFIG_PCI_IOV
>>>>                       struct pci_dev *pdev =
>>>>                               list_entry(entry, struct
>>>> pci_dev,
>>>> bus_list);
>>>> 
>>>>                       /* don't count virtual functions
>> */
>>>>                       if (pdev->is_virtfn)
>>>>                               continue;
>>>> #endif
>>>> 
>>>>                        physfns++; <------ Should only be
>>>> incremented
>>>> when an Intel NIC is found
>>>>               }
>>>> 
>>>> I can send  a patch but not sure if what I am thinking is
>>>> the correct way
>>>> to solve this.
